INTRODUCTION: Viruses are responsible for two-thirds of all acute respiratory tract infections. This study aims to retrospectively detect respiratory tract viruses in patients from all age groups who visited the hospital. METHODOLOGY: A total of 1592 samples from 1416 patients with respiratory tract symptoms were sent from several clinics to the Molecular Microbiology Laboratory at Gazi University Hospital from February 2016 to January 2019. Nucleic acid extraction from nasopharyngeal swabs, throat swabs or bronchoalveolar lavage (BAL) samples sent to our laboratory was done using a commercial automated system. Extracted nucleic acids were amplified by a commercial multiplex-real time Polymerase Chain Reaction (PCR) method, which can detect 18 viral respiratory pathogens. RESULTS: Among 1592 samples, 914 (57.4%) were positive for respiratory viruses. The most prevalent were rhinovirus (25.2%) and influenza A virus (12.1%), the least prevalent was the bocavirus (2.6%). Rhinovirus was the most detected as a single agent (21.2%, 194/914) among all positive cases, followed by coronavirus (9.3%, 85/914). The detection rates of coronavirus, human adenovirus, respiratory syncytial virus A/B, human parainfluenza viruses, human metapneumovirus-A/B, human parechovirus, enterovirus and influenza B virus were 9.9%, 8%, 7.7%, 5%, 3.4%, 3.1%, 3%, and 2.8%, respectively. CONCLUSIONS: The most detected viral agents in our study were influenza A virus and rhinovirus. Laboratory diagnosis of respiratory viruses is helpful to prevent unnecessary antibiotic use and is essential in routine diagnostics for antiviral treatment. Multiplex Real-time PCR method is fast and useful for the diagnosis of viral respiratory infections.

Thoracic air leak syndromes (TALS) are very rare among the noninfectious pulmonary complications (PCs). They can either be idiopathic or have several risk factors such as allogeneic hematopoietic stem cell transplantation (allo-HSCT), graft versus host disease and rarely pulmonary aspergillosis. We present a 14-year-old girl with hypoplastic myelodysplastic syndrome who developed graft versus host disease on day 60, TALS on day 150, bronchiolitis obliterans syndrome on day 300, pulmonary aspergillosis on day 400 and COVID-19 pneumonia on day 575 after allo-HSCT. This is the first report of a child who developed these subsequent PCs after allo-HSCT. Therefore, the manifestations of these unfamiliar PCs like TALS and COVID-19 pneumonia, and concomitant pulmonary aspergillosis with management options are discussed.

Mycobacterium abscessus appears to be increasing cause of pulmonary infection in children with underlying risk factors including cystic fibrosis, chronic lung disease and immunodeficiency syndromes. We present a case of pulmonary M. abscessus infection in a pediatric patient with primary ciliary dyskinesia and he was successfully treated with parenteral amikacin, linezolid and oral clarithromycin combined with inhaled amikacin. Clinical improvement was observed after adding inhaled amikacin to the treatment.

OBJECTIVES: Antimicrobial prophylaxis (AP) is an important means of reducing surgical site infections. The goal of this study was to evaluate the perioperative AP in paediatric practice and its compliance with surgical prophylaxis guidelines. METHODS: A prospective study was conducted at Gazi University Faculty of Medicine, between September 2015 and April 2016. Paediatric patients who underwent surgical procedures were included in the study. Surgical AP was evaluated. RESULTS: During the entire study period, 466 children underwent surgery at our centre; 433 (92.7%) received antimicrobial prophylaxis. Overall adherence to the guidelines regarding surgical prophylaxis was 22.1%. The rate of administration of surgical prophylaxis was significantly lower, and the duration was shorter when the surgical procedure was clean (P = 0.002). When the duration of the procedure was longer, the rate of administration of prophylaxis was higher (P = 0.000). The duration of postoperative prophylaxis was longer than recommended in 72.2% of the patients. In the multivariate analysis, application errors increased with longer surgical time (P = 0.01, OR 2.18, 95% CI 1.19-4.03). CONCLUSIONS: High rates of misapplication of antimicrobial surgical prophylaxis were observed in this study. Awareness and usage of guidelines should be encouraged. The education of clinicians should be supported by studies regarding surgical prophylaxis in children.

Background/aim: Bacteremia remains an important cause of morbidity and mortality during febrile neutropenia (FN) episodes. We aimed to define the risk factors for bacteremia in febrile neutropenic children with hemato-oncological malignancies. Materials and methods: The records of 150 patients aged ≤18 years who developed FN in hematology and oncology clinics were retrospectively evaluated. Patients with bacteremia were compared to patients with negative blood cultures. Results: The mean age of the patients was 7.5 ± 4.8 years. Leukemia was more prevalent than solid tumors (61.3% vs. 38.7%). Bacteremia was present in 23.3% of the patients. Coagulase-negative staphylococci were the most frequently isolated microorganism. Leukopenia, severe neutropenia, positive peripheral blood and central line cultures during the previous 3 months, presence of a central line, previous FN episode(s), hypotension, tachycardia, and tachypnea were found to be risk factors for bacteremia. Positive central line cultures during the previous 3 months and presence of previous FN episode(s) were shown to increase bacteremia risk by 2.4-fold and 2.5-fold, respectively. Conclusion: Presence of a bacterial growth in central line cultures during the previous 3 months and presence of any previous FN episode(s) were shown to increase bacteremia risk by 2.4-fold and 2.5-fold, respectively. These factors can predict bacteremia in children with FN.

Nocardia spp is a gram-positive aerobic filamentous bacteria that causes pulmonary and systemic infections, especially in patients with immunosuppression or chronic lung diseases. It is rarely reported in children with cystic fibrosis. Macrophage activation syndrome is a life-threatening disease with an excessive inflammatory response usually triggered by infections. There are few reports in cystic fibrosis related to macrophage activation syndrome. Herein we report a child with cystic fibrosis who had macrophage activation syndrome due to Nocardia infection.

OBJECTIVES: The aim of this point prevalence survey was to evaluate the consumption, indications and strategies of antifungal therapy in the paediatric population in Turkey. METHODS: A point prevalence study was performed at 25 hospitals. In addition to general data on paediatric units of the institutes, the generic name and indication of antifungal drugs, the presence of fungal isolation and susceptibility patterns, and the presence of galactomannan test and high-resolution computed tomography (HRCT) results were reviewed. RESULTS: A total of 3338 hospitalised patients were evaluated. The number of antifungal drugs prescribed was 314 in 301 patients (9.0%). Antifungal drugs were mostly prescribed in paediatric haematology and oncology (PHO) units (35.2%), followed by neonatal ICUs (NICUs) (19.6%), paediatric services (18.3%), paediatric ICUs (PICUs) (14.6%) and haematopoietic stem cell transplantation (HSCT) units (7.3%). Antifungals were used for prophylaxis in 147 patients (48.8%) and for treatment in 154 patients (50.0%). The antifungal treatment strategy in 154 patients was empirical in 77 (50.0%), diagnostic-driven in 29 (18.8%) and targeted in 48 (31.2%). At the point of decision-making for diagnostic-driven antifungal therapy in 29 patients, HRCT had not been performed in 1 patient (3.4%) and galactomannan test results were not available in 12 patients (41.4%). Thirteen patients (8.4%) were receiving eight different antifungal combination therapies. CONCLUSION: The majority of antifungal drugs for treatment and prophylaxis were prescribed in PHO and HSCT units (42.5%), followed by ICUs. Thus, antifungal stewardship programmes should mainly focus on these patients within the availability of diagnostic tests of each hospital.

The aim of this study is to document the clinical characteristics and outcomes of Acinetobacter baumannii infections in pediatric patients in a pediatric intensive care unit (PICU) in Turkey. The ages ranged from 1 month to 16 years with a mean age of 55.5 months, and the male-to-female ratio was 1:1.5. Ventilator-associated pneumonia (10 patients) was the leading diagnosis, followed by catheter-related blood stream infection (4 patients), and bacteremia and ventilator-associated pneumonia associated with meningitis (1 patient) due to A. baumannii. Mechanical ventilation (93.3%), central venous catheter (73.3%), urinary catheter (93.3%), and broad spectrum antibiotic usage (80%) were the frequently seen risk factors. Neuromuscular (40%) and malignant (26.7%) disorders were the most common underlying diseases. Nosocomial A. baumannii is commonly multidrug-resistant, prolongs the length of stay in the PICU and increases the mortality rates in pediatric critical care.

BACKGROUND: In April 2009 a novel strain of human influenza A, identified as H1N1 virus, rapidly spread worldwide, and in early June 2009 the World Health Organization raised the pandemic alert level to phase 6. Herein we present the largest series of children who were hospitalized due to pandemic H1N1 infection in Turkey. METHODS: We conducted a retrospective multicentre analysis of case records involving children hospitalized with influenza-like illness, in whom 2009 H1N1 influenza was diagnosed by reverse-transcriptase polymerase chain reaction assay, at 17 different tertiary hospitals. RESULTS: A total of 821 children with 2009 pandemic H1N1 were hospitalized. The majority of admitted children (56.9%) were younger than 5 y of age. Three hundred and seventy-six children (45.8%) had 1 or more pre-existing conditions. Respiratory complications including wheezing, pneumonia, pneumothorax, pneumomediastinum, and hypoxemia were seen in 272 (33.2%) children. Ninety of the patients (11.0%) were admitted or transferred to the paediatric intensive care units (PICU) and 52 (6.3%) received mechanical ventilation. Thirty-five children (4.3%) died. The mortality rate did not differ between age groups. Of the patients who died, 25.7% were healthy before the H1N1 virus infection. However, the death rate was significantly higher in patients with malignancy, chronic neurological disease, immunosuppressive therapy, at least 1 pre-existing condition, and respiratory complications. The most common causes of mortality were pneumonia and sepsis. CONCLUSIONS: In Turkey, 2009 H1N1 infection caused high mortality and PICU admission due to severe respiratory illness and complications, especially in children with an underlying condition.

Visceral leishmaniasis (VL), is a systemic disease caused by the dissemination of protozoan parasite Leishmania throughout the reticuloendothelial system. It may mimic or lead to several types of hematological disorders including hemophagocytosis. Infection associated hemophagocytic syndrome implicating Leishmania is very rare and often difficult to diagnose. Here, we describe a child with hemophagocytic lymphohistiocytosis (HLH) associated with VL.
